What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ers as a token of appreciation for their service. It is typically calculated as a percentage of the total bill, with common percentages ranging from 15% to 20% in the hospitality industry. Understanding percentages helps in determining how much to tip based on the total cost of your meal or service.
How to Tip?
When calculating a tip, consider the quality of service you received. A standard tip is usually around 15-20% of the total bill. For a quick calculation, multiply the total amount by the tip percentage (as a decimal). For instance, to tip 3% on a $32 bill, you would calculate $32 x 0.03.

How do you calculate a 3% tip on a $32 bill?
To calculate a 3% tip on a $32 bill, multiply $32 by 0.03, which equals $0.96. Therefore, a 3% tip would be $0.96.
Is 3% a reasonable tip?
While a 3% tip is technically an option, it is considered below the standard tipping range. Typically, a tip of 15-20% is recommended for satisfactory service.
What if I want to tip more than 3%?
If you want to tip more than 3%, simply use the desired percentage in your calculation. For example, for a 20% tip, multiply $32 by 0.20, which equals $6.40.
